Case IH updates balers for 2027

LB4, LB6, RB6 and RB6 HD Pro lines receive changes in material flow, automation, connectivity and baling

24.06.2026 | 09:15 (UTC -3)
Cultivar Magazine, based on information from Jana Wolf

Case IH has introduced updates to its baler line for the 2027 model year. The changes encompass the LB4 and LB6 large prismatic balers, as well as the RB6 and RB6 HD Pro round balers. The company reports improvements in productivity, durability, automation, and connectivity.

In the LB4 and LB6 lines, Case IH included a Rotor Feeder option. The system aims to maintain a continuous and controlled flow of material. The proposal involves greater yield and performance in different crop conditions.

The Rotor Cutter version now features up to 57 blades. This configuration increases cutting capacity and operational flexibility. The new lightweight blade drawer facilitates access and cleaning. Individual blade protection and simple cutting length adjustment allow for adaptation to changes in the field.

RB6 line

In the RB6 line, the updates target durability, bale uniformity, and simple operation. The baling chamber has been reinforced. Central components have also received improvements. According to Case IH, the changes help maintain bale quality and reduce long-term maintenance requirements.

The RB6 also received an expanded offering of monitors and factory preparation for automation between the tractor and baler. The system for the tractor wraps the bale and ejects it, requiring less operator intervention.

RB6 HD Pro Line

The RB6 HD Pro has received updates designed for large farms and service providers. Mechanical improvements aim to optimize material flow. Case IH FieldOps connectivity now offers baling data, field performance information, bale tracking, and mapping.

Case IH has also introduced Nature's Net Wrap on the RB6 and RB6 HD Pro lines. The compostable netting uses plant-based materials. This option aims to maintain wrapping performance and bale integrity, while also reducing plastic waste and disposal needs.

The Case IH 2027 model year line will be available starting in the third quarter of 2027.
